Title: Innovations of Inventor Xiao Lu
Introduction
Xiao Lu is a notable inventor based in Liaoning, China. He has made significant contributions to the field of toolpath design, particularly for complex curved surfaces. His innovative approach aims to enhance machining accuracy and stability.
Latest Patents
Xiao Lu holds a patent for a "Toolpath topology design method based on vector field in sub-regional processing for curved surface." This method involves finding functional relationships in feeding direction between chord error and normal curvature, as well as between scallop-height error and normal curvature. He establishes a bi-objective optimization model to calculate the optimal feeding direction at each cutting contact point on the surface. The method also includes building a space vector field, calculating divergence and rotation of the projected vector field, and classifying different sub-regions to achieve primary surface segmentation. This innovative technique is particularly beneficial for complex curved surface processing, as it reduces machining errors and enhances feed motion stability.
